This is a nice, relaxed lounge located in the lobby of the hotel. There is running water, piped music, and waitresses to serve drinks and snacks. It leads to a bar area which again is a cosy, relaxed area to chill out. Some nights whilst we were there were a couple of Chinese girls singing with an electric organ. We found it a little annoying, and the sound was quite loud. Also their singing was not the best I have ever heard.

But if all you want is a drink to wind down at the end of the day, then this is a good place.

This restaurant is located on the second floor of the Renaissance Pudong hotel, and you can either have a buffet or order from the menu.

The buffet was extensive and consisted of both Chinese and western food. You have to order drinks separately, and sometimes the waiters were a little slow delivering.

If you order from the menu you get a good choice of food. Anything from sandwiches to pizza, Chinese to pasta, and other things in between. I had one of the nicest pizzas I have ever had at this restaurant.

The prices for both the menu and buffet were good and I would recommend this restaurant, as they seem capable of catering to most tastes.
